Glass ceiling -?The term Glass ceiling has often used?to describe invisible barrier in the workplace.
The term Glass Ceiling was first introduced used in 1978 by Marilyn Loden at a pavelist discussion about women in the workplace.
Glass ceiling refers to the fact that a qualified person wishing to advance within the hierarchy of his/her organization is stopped at a lower level due to a discrimination most often based on sexism or racism.
There are three types of Glass ceiling-
* Gender Bias Glass celling
* Cultural Glass Ceiling
*Racial Glass ceiling??
Gender Bias is the tendency?to prefer male gender over a female.
Cultural Glass ceiling -A reference to the term, the glass ceiling, has come to embody more than gender equality among women and men. Today the term embraces the quest of all minorities and their journey towards equality in the workplace.?
Racial Glass ceiling - A concept used to describe a group of people who share physical characteristics, such as skin color and facial features discrimination in workplace.
